My images about the future are normally optimistic. This one has perhaps a mixed feeling, depending on your interpretation.


The titles comes from a poem by Lewis Carrol. It seemed appropriate.

This was, as always, rendered in Vue.

Ah, I understand now. Well, you may find it strange but I do have a tool to boost my imagination: a hot shower. Sometimes, when I'm stuck on some concept and can't unwrap it, I go to the shower, close my eyes with hot water pouring down, let my mind wander freely and a few minutes later, most often than not, an idea will come up. Try it, maybe it'll work with you too.
And yes, I know exactly what you mean. Many times I look at an image and think exactly what you said. This normally happens with character images. I prefer to make landscapes and environments but truth is that when I try to create an original character I fail miserably.
